What affects the price

Replacing your roof involves several variables that shift your final bill. The total square footage of your property is the biggest factor, followed closely by the pitch or steepness of your roof, which dictates how safely crews can work. You will also need to choose your materials—architectural shingles, metal, or tile each carry different price points. We also have to account for the removal and disposal of your current roof, plus the condition of the underlying wood decking that might need repairs once the old shingles are off. About this service

Roof sealant is a specialized coating used to bridge small gaps and waterproof vulnerable areas like flashing, vents, and joints. It creates a seamless barrier that stops water from seeping into your home's structure. You typically need this when you notice minor leaks or when your roof's existing seals start to dry out or crack due to sun exposure. Regular maintenance, including checking these seals, can prevent much larger, more expensive problems from developing inside your walls or ceilings.

What is TPO roofing, and is it good for Miami?

TPO (Thermoplastic Olefin) is a single-ply roofing membrane that's highly reflective and energy-efficient, making it an excellent choice for Miami's sunny climate. It's durable, resistant to punctures, and offers great waterproofing. TPO is commonly used on flat or low-slope roofs for both commercial and residential buildings. It helps keep buildings cooler, reducing energy costs. Discuss TPO suitability with a local roofing specialist.

What is roof maintenance, and how often should I do it in Miami?

Roof maintenance in Miami involves regular checks for damage, cleaning gutters, and clearing debris. Given the intense sun and heavy rains, it's advisable to have your roof inspected at least once a year, and after any major storm. What are roof tiles, and are they good for Miami?

Roof tiles, such as clay or concrete, can be a beautiful and durable option for Miami homes. They offer excellent fire resistance and can withstand high winds. Tiles also provide good insulation against the heat. However, they are heavy and require a strong roof structure. The initial cost can also be higher. What are commercial roofing options near me in Miami?

Commercial roofing options near Miami include TPO, EPDM (rubber roofing), modified bitumen, and various metal systems. These are chosen for their durability, waterproofing, and suitability for flat or low-slope roofs common on commercial buildings.
